due process

Meaning

Noun

  • A legal concept where a person is ensured all legal rights when deprived of their liberty for a given reason.
  • The limits of laws and legal proceedings, so as to ensure a person fairness, justice and liberty.

Origin

  • From Middle English dewe processe, from Anglo-Norman due procés.
